  • Legal Analyst - Lagos - N.U.E Offshore Resources Limited

    N.U.E Offshore Resources Limited
    N.U.E Offshore Resources Limited Lagos

    2 months ago

    Description
    Job Summary

    N.U.E Offshore Resources Limited is a leading organization specializing in maritime security, dedicated to ensuring the safety and protection of global maritime assets.

    Our work spans across vessel security, anti-piracy operations, and compliance with international maritime laws.

    We are seeking a skilled corporate Legal Analyst to join our team and ensure our operations adhere to all relevant legal frameworks, while effectively managing legal risks in the maritime domain.

    Responsibilities
    Ensure the legality of commercial transactions.
    Advise cooperation on their legal rights and duties.
    Ensure Employers confidentiality must be maintained.
    Analyses and preparation of memorandum of understanding with partners/clients.
    Advise clients concerning business transactions, claim liability, advisability of prosecuting or defending lawsuits, or legal rights and obligations.
    Interpret laws, rulings and regulations for individuals and businesses.
    Analyze the probable outcomes of cases, using knowledge of legal precedents.
    Evaluate findings and develop strategies and arguments in preparation for presentation of cases.
    Prepare and draft legal documents such as wills, deeds, patent applications, mortgages, leases, and contracts.
    Confer colleagues with specialties in appropriate areas of legal issue to establish and verify bases for legal proceedings.
    Act as agent, trustee, guardian or executor for businesses or individuals.
    Prepare legal briefs, develop strategies, arguments, and testimony in preparation of presentation for case.
    Work closely with other heads of department in ensuring efficient running of the organization.
    Involvement in other aspects of the business.
    Prepare weekly report and present to management at weekly meetings.
    Work closely with the document control department in ensuring all legal documents are up to date.
    Prepare monthly audit reports on all statutory and NIMASA documents/ certificates.

    Qualifications
    Proficiency in Law and Legal Document Preparation
    Strong Analytical Skills and experience with Contractual Agreements
    Excellent Communication skills, both written and verbal
    Attention to detail and strong organizational skills
    Ability to work independently and in a team-oriented environment
    Relevant experience in the Oil & Gas or Maritime sector is a plus
    Bachelor's degree in Law (LL.B) or related field
